Serie A side Fiorentina have begun making preparations for their summer transfer campaign which includes trying to tempt AC Milan’s Ignazio Abate to the Stadio Artemio Franchi.

The Rossoneri right-back skippered the side in the recent Milan derby but has yet to have his contract renewed, a deal which is set to expire at the end of the current campaign.

According to La Nazione, the Viola will try and take advantage of the delay by offering the Italy international a new opportunity away from the Stadio Meazza. He could also be joined by Genoa’s Sebastian De Maio and Bayer Leverkusen’s Giulio Donati, as the Florence-based outfit look to redesign their defence.

However, nothing will be rubber-stamped until the future of coach Vincenzo Montella has been resolved, with many rumours linking the tactician with a switch to Abate’s AC Milan.

The ex-Catania boss is set to have a meeting with Fiorentina owner Andrea Della Valle once the current season is over to discuss whether or not he will remain at the helm of the side.
